Millstream Properties I, LLC c/o Ed Flynn Page 2 9. PROJECT DESCRIPTION: The project site is located at 1905 N. Lumina Ave., adjacent to Banks Channel, between the Atlantic Ocean and Greenville Sound. The site is located within the Town of Wrightsville Beach, in New Hanover County. The applicant currently maintains a single-family residence on the project site. The property is adjacent to residential properties with existing single family structures and private docking facilities. Highground vegetation consists of ornamental landscaping. The lot is approximately 0.46 acres in size and has an average elevation of approximately 6' above normal high water (NHW). The project site has approximately 92 linear feet of shoreline frontage stabilized by an existing concrete retaining wall, which meets NHW. There is an existing concrete boat ramp near the southern end of the property that measures approximately 10' in width. NHW is approximately 5' landward of the bulkhead in the area of the boat ramp. There is a patch of Coastal Wetlands consisting primarily of Smooth Cordgrass (Spartina alterniflora), which measures approximately 35' in width and is located north of the existing fixed pier. The applicant currently maintains an existing docking facility within Banks Channel. An access pier, measuring approximately 55' in length by 4' in width extends in a westerly direction from the existing retaining wall. The pier terminates onto a covered platform, measuring approximately 16' in length by 16' in width, which is centered creating an "T -head" configuration. An access ramp leads from the platform onto a floating dock, measuring approximately 20' in length by 14' in width, which runs in the same alignment as the access pier. On the north side of the pier is an existing boat lift measuring approximately 13' in width by 13' in length. There are two existing tie pilings on the north side of the ramp leading to the floating platform. There are also three tie pilings running perpendicular to the shoreline approximately 15' from the southern edge of the floating dock. The existing floating dock exceeds to Town of Wrightsville Beach's Pierhead Line by 5' and one tie piling exceeds the Pierhead Line by 13'. The existing docking facility currently accommodates up to two (2) vessels. The Town of Wrightsville Beach Land Use Plan classifies adjacent waters and high ground area of project site as Conservation. There are no known archaeological sites located in the project vicinity. The waters of Banks Channel are classified SB by the Division of Water Resources. They are NOT designated as a Primary Nursery Area (PNA) by the N.C. Division of Marine Fisheries and they are CLOSED to the harvest of shellfish. PROPOSED PROJECT: The applicant proposes to expand an existing private docking facility within Banks Channel. A new finger pier, measuring approximately 24' in length by 5' in width would be constructed approximately 4' from the terminus on the southern side of the existing floating platform. The application states that the existing water depth in the location of the proposed structure would be approximately -6' at normal low water (NLW). The proposed expansion of the existing docking facility would accommodate up to three (3) slips at this location (see Sheets 2 of 4). The existing floating platform, boat lift and tie pilings would remain, including those portions that exceed the Town of Wrightsville Beach's Pierhead Line. No work is proposed on these structures beyond the addition of the floating finger pier. Millstream Properties I, LLC c/o Ed Flynn Page 3 10. ANTICIPATED IMPACTS: The proposed structure would incorporate an additional 120 sq. ft. of Estuarine Waters and Public Trust Areas. The proposed structure would not encroach into either adjacent 15' Riparian Corridor Setback Area requirement. The current facility extends approximately 71' into a waterbody, which measures approximately 890' across. The proposed finger pier would not encroach any further into the waterbody than the existing structures, and conforms to the 1/4 width rule and the locally established pier head line. Minor increases in turbidity should be expected during construction. Submitted by: Courtney Spears Date: 10/24/2017 Office: Wilmington F d S Marine Contractors, Inc, P.
